About the Role
- Hunting for New Business: Proactively prospecting through self‑sourced and company‑provided leads.
- Tailoring Solutions: Face‑to‑face and virtual consultations to understand customer needs and offer tailored digital marketing solutions.
- Closing Deals: Present, negotiate and seal the deal to drive revenue growth.
- Client Management: Nurture relationships and ensure a seamless customer experience for up to 12 months post‑sale.
- Data Analysis: Identify opportunities for growth, boost client ROI and deliver long‑term success.
Qualifications
- Proven track record in sales (Field Sales or High‑Performing Tele‑Sales).
- Strong relationship‑building and negotiation skills.
- Resilience and a positive outlook in overcoming objections.
- Excellent presentation skills—both verbal and written.
- Experience in solution selling or SaaS (desirable).
- A full UK driving licence with no more than 6 points.
Why Join Us
- Competitive Earnings: Base salary £35,875 with uncapped commission OTE and car allowance.
- Perks & Benefits: 23 days holiday (increasing each year), employee referral schemes, wellbeing support, flexible pension options, and retailer discounts.
- Career Growth: Clear paths to roles such as Senior Account Manager, Digital Account Director and access to the Aspire Program.
- Recognition & Rewards: Reward and recognition schemes including the Yell ‘Hartley Awards.’
- Top‑Tier Partners: Work with leading brands such as Google, Wix, Alexa and Microsoft.
- Supportive Culture: Motivated, high‑performing team working together to achieve success.

How to prepare for a job interview at Yell
✨Know Your Numbers
Before the interview, brush up on your sales metrics and achievements. Be ready to discuss specific targets you've smashed and how you achieved them. This shows you're results-driven and can back up your claims with solid evidence.
✨Tailor Your Approach
Research Yell and understand their digital marketing solutions. Think about how your experience aligns with their offerings and be prepared to discuss how you can tailor solutions for potential clients. This will demonstrate your proactive mindset and solution-selling skills.
✨Practice Your Pitch
Since you'll be closing deals, practice your presentation skills. Prepare a mock pitch for a hypothetical client, focusing on how you'd identify their needs and present tailored solutions. This will help you feel more confident during the actual interview.
✨Build Rapport
During the interview, focus on building a connection with your interviewer. Use your relationship-building skills to engage them in conversation. Ask insightful questions about the company culture and team dynamics to show your genuine interest in joining their high-performing team.
